Understanding the CompTIA N10-009 Exam
Before jumping into resources, it’s important to understand what the exam measures.
Exam details:
-
Exam code: N10-009
-
Type: Multiple-choice and performance-based questions (PBQs)
-
Duration: 90 minutes
-
Number of questions: Up to 90
-
Passing score: 720 (on a scale of 100–900)
-
Recommended experience: 9–12 months of networking experience
Main domains covered:
-
Networking Fundamentals – Core networking concepts, topologies, and models.
-
Network Implementations – Configuring routers, switches, and wireless devices.
-
Network Operations – Monitoring, managing, and troubleshooting network performance.
-
Network Security – Securing devices, traffic, and configurations.
-
Network Troubleshooting – Diagnosing and resolving connectivity issues.
The N10-009 focuses more on real-world problem-solving, so your preparation must emphasize applied learning over rote memorization.

Best Labs and Hands-On Platforms for N10-009 Exam
Since the N10-009 includes performance-based questions, practical experience is essential. These labs provide guided, interactive learning in a safe, virtual environment.
1. CompTIA CertMaster Labs (Official)
-
Designed to complement CertMaster Learn or self-study.
-
Walks you through networking configurations, device management, and troubleshooting tasks.
-
Provides real-time feedback and cloud-based lab environments — no hardware needed.
2. Cisco Packet Tracer
-
Free simulation software from Cisco that lets you build and configure virtual networks.
-
Ideal for mastering routing, switching, and connectivity troubleshooting.
-
Great for understanding network flow and practicing subnetting exercises.
3. NetLab+
-
Offered by NDG (Network Development Group), often through partner institutions.
-
Provides realistic labs on routing, switching, firewalls, and wireless technologies.
-
Ideal for schools, training centers, or self-learners looking for guided, enterprise-level experience.
4. GNS3 (Graphical Network Simulator)
-
Perfect for advanced learners who want to simulate real networking environments.
-
Lets you emulate routers and switches with actual network OS images.
-
Best suited for those comfortable with manual setup and configuration.
5. Practice Platforms like TryHackMe or Skillable
-
Offer hands-on exercises in network security, monitoring, and troubleshooting.
-
Good supplements for the “Network Security” and “Operations” domains.
How to Combine Practice Exams and Labs Effectively
To make the most of these tools, follow a structured approach:
-
Start with domain-based learning. Study one topic (for example, routing) and then practice it in labs.
-
Use practice exams to measure progress weekly. Review your results and focus on weaker areas.
-
Revisit concepts through hands-on labs. Apply what you learned in real or simulated environments.
-
Track improvement over time. Use score reports or spreadsheets to measure consistency.
-
Simulate full exams near the end. Take at least two timed tests before your actual exam day.
Additional Study Tips
-
Review the official exam objectives. Use them as a checklist throughout your preparation.
-
Focus on subnetting and IP addressing. These topics appear frequently in PBQs.
-
Practice troubleshooting logic. Learn how to isolate causes and apply solutions systematically.
